QUAYAGE
Dictionary entry overview: What does quayage mean? • QUAYAGE (noun)
The noun QUAYAGE has 1 sense:
1. a fee charged for the use of a wharf or quay
Familiarity information: QUAYAGE used as a noun is very rare.
